Output 74f26ac051b3b68e66a89974e471c5dfa3c2f10cdbf7d0da53918257c3d244a3:13

value
12249954
script pubkey
OP_0 OP_PUSHBYTES_20 505c825517c349530343777c68fc4bf8c9d59418
address
bc1q2pwgy4ghcdy4xq6rwa7x3lztlryat9qcc3rwu7
transaction
74f26ac051b3b68e66a89974e471c5dfa3c2f10cdbf7d0da53918257c3d244a3
spent
true